
Ty Segall
“Running To Nowhere”
Drag City
Today he follows up lead single "Black Paint" with "Running To Nowhere." Whereas the former was a high-flying classic rocker with harmonies to spare, the latter is harder and heavier, powered by gnarly low-end riffs and haunted by amelodic howls. They certainly make room for some prettiness in there, though. -Stereogum
